Spaces:
Running
Running
Commit
·
22c5f0f
1
Parent(s):
dfe8f6f
fix: oor
Browse files
src/improved_diffusion/gaussian_diffusion.py
CHANGED
|
@@ -679,6 +679,7 @@ class GaussianDiffusion:
|
|
| 679 |
caption[1].to(img.device),
|
| 680 |
) # (caption_state, caption_mask)
|
| 681 |
my_bar = st.progress(0, text="Processing")
|
|
|
|
| 682 |
for pro, i in enumerate(indices):
|
| 683 |
t = torch.tensor([i] * shape[0], device=device)
|
| 684 |
with torch.no_grad():
|
|
@@ -694,7 +695,7 @@ class GaussianDiffusion:
|
|
| 694 |
)
|
| 695 |
yield out
|
| 696 |
img = out["sample"]
|
| 697 |
-
my_bar.progress(pro, text="Processing")
|
| 698 |
my_bar.empty()
|
| 699 |
|
| 700 |
def p_sample_loop_langevin_progressive(
|
|
|
|
| 679 |
caption[1].to(img.device),
|
| 680 |
) # (caption_state, caption_mask)
|
| 681 |
my_bar = st.progress(0, text="Processing")
|
| 682 |
+
max_pro = len(indices)
|
| 683 |
for pro, i in enumerate(indices):
|
| 684 |
t = torch.tensor([i] * shape[0], device=device)
|
| 685 |
with torch.no_grad():
|
|
|
|
| 695 |
)
|
| 696 |
yield out
|
| 697 |
img = out["sample"]
|
| 698 |
+
my_bar.progress((pro + 1) / max_pro, text="Processing")
|
| 699 |
my_bar.empty()
|
| 700 |
|
| 701 |
def p_sample_loop_langevin_progressive(
|